Restore of a Qtree from a Snapvault in Provisioning Manager fails

muhammad_i_pasha
3,640 Views

I am trying to restore a  Qtree from a vault location to the original location using PM. Protection Policy on Dataset is Mirror and then Backup. It seems PM starts the restore but then fails with the following message

"primary stopped accepting data; is destination file system full?"

Destination volume is not full and snapvault.access is set to *.

This is a valid error we get when volume runs of the space.

See if there is any message like this in the filer EMS.

[wafl.vol.full:notice]: file system on volume <volume name> is full

Issue is now resolved. Protection Manager error reporting wasn't right.

PM was using snapvault restore but snapvault.access wasn't set for destination filer.
